A standard residential installation in Melbourne now typically ranges from A$1,950 to over A$16,000, depending on the complexity of your home's layout and the system you choose. We often see people tempted by supply-only deals at major retailers. While a unit might look like a bargain at A$850, this does not include the specialized labour required for a safe setup. A comprehensive supply-and-install package provides you with a holistic service, covering the unit, copper piping, electrical circuits, and expert calibration. Opting for "cheap" or unlicensed installations often results in a 25% increase in long-term maintenance costs. Poorly installed units leak refrigerant or vibrate excessively, which shortens the system's lifespan and increases your energy bills. We want you to feel secure, so we always recommend prioritizing quality over the lowest initial price. In Victoria, compliance is a non-negotiable standard for your protection. Any work valued over A$750 requires a Victorian Building Authority (VBA) Plumbing Compliance Certificate. You also must receive a Certificate of Electrical Safety. These documents are your guarantee that the work meets Australian Standard AS/NZS 3000. They protect your home insurance and give you peace of mind that your family is safe. Here are the 2026 price benchmarks for Melbourne homes:- Single Split Systems: These are perfect for individual bedrooms or small lounges. You can expect to pay between A$1,850 and A$3,600 for a fully installed 2.5kW to 7.1kW unit.
- Multi-Split Systems: If you want to cool three or four rooms using only one outdoor compressor, the cost of installing air con in this category ranges from A$5,500 to A$10,500. It's a tailored solution for homes with limited outdoor space.
- Ducted Systems: For whole-home climate control in larger Melbourne properties, the investment starts at A$11,000 and can reach A$22,000 for high-efficiency, zoned systems that offer maximum independence and comfort.
The "Back-to-Back" Benchmark
A "back-to-back" installation is the industry standard for a straightforward, single-storey home setup. This means the indoor unit sits directly on the opposite side of the wall from the outdoor compressor. A base-level fee for this typically includes up to 3 metres of refrigerant pipework, 15 metres of electrical cabling, and a dedicated 20-amp circuit. It's a clean, efficient way to bring cooling into your life without major structural changes. Your home might deviate from this standard price if you live in a double-storey townhouse or if the outdoor unit needs to be mounted on a roof bracket. In 2026, additional piping beyond the standard 3 metres usually costs roughly A$75 per metre. If your switchboard requires an upgrade to handle the new power load, you should budget an extra A$600 to A$1,200. Each requires a tailored approach to ensure your system runs safely and efficiently for years. One major factor involves the distance between your indoor unit and the outdoor compressor. Most standard installations include a 3 meter pipe run. If your layout requires the compressor to sit on a roof or 15 meters away in a side passage, costs rise. You'll pay for extra copper piping and additional refrigerant gas, often R32, which can add $60 to $120 per extra meter. Choosing an efficient unit is vital here. Safety is our primary concern when we discuss home modifications. Older Melbourne switchboards often lack the capacity for modern, high-draw appliances. If your board still uses ceramic fuses, a mandatory upgrade to RCD safety switches is necessary, costing between $800 and $1,500. For any unit larger than 7kW, Victorian regulations require a dedicated circuit back to the main board. This ensures your system won't trip the lights when the compressor kicks in. Every installation must also include a Certificate of Electrical Safety (COES). In Victoria, the lodgement fee is approximately $35 to $60, but the peace of mind it provides for your insurance and family safety is priceless.Installation Complexity and Property Layout
The material of your walls dictates the labour time involved. Drilling through a standard timber stud wall takes 15 minutes. In contrast, diamond core drilling through double-brick or bluestone common in Melbourne's inner suburbs can take two hours. If you live in a multi-storey townhouse, we must consider the logistics of lifting a 40kg compressor. Scaffolding or specialized lifting equipment can add $500 to a quote instantly. Victoria is actively moving away from gas to create a cleaner future. Since January 1, 2024, new homes haven't been allowed to connect to the gas network, and the incentives to decommission old gas ducted heaters are at an all-time high. This shift is driven by the superior efficiency of modern heat pumps. While an old gas furnace might struggle with a 70% efficiency rating, a modern reverse cycle system can achieve 300% to 600% efficiency by moving heat rather than creating it. Melbourne sits in the "Cold" zone on the Zoned Energy Rating Label (ZERL). You should always check the blue map icon on the sticker to see how a unit performs in our specific climate. A 5-star reverse cycle system can reduce your annual running costs by approximately A$320 compared to a 2-star alternative. Modern inverter technology is the secret behind these savings. It adjusts the motor speed to maintain temperature instead of switching it on and off constantly. This prevents the massive energy spikes that wear down your equipment and lead to expensive repairs.The Power of Solar-Assisted Cooling
